In the framework of the Crans Montana Forum on the South-South Cooperation, to take place in Brussels, March 7-10, 2012, will be held a special Women’s Programme devoted to « Enhancing Women Dignity » exceptionally co-organized by the Forum, UNESCO & ISESCO.
In its fight for the dignity of Human beings and against all sorts of discrimination, the Crans Montana Forum has constantly supported Initiatives recognizing women’s rights and removing all the obstacles to women’s active participation in decision-making.
The Crans Montana Forum states that an equal involvement of Men and Women in all fields of the Public life is essential for Sustainable Development, Welfare and Peace.
Once again this year, this special Programme will gather First Ladies, Ministers and decision-makers from the public and private sectors.
